Re: Comparison: ASU & UNCC Football Programs
Online courses are currently becoming a joke in the professional world (well I shouldn't be that broad).... in the Criminal Justice world we scrutinize the heck out of folks who apply and have online degrees. Most we don't honor. If the online course you took is all online with no test where you actually have to go somewhere and sit and take the test (or some time of final) then most are worthless. I have seen many people take online courses only to have others do the class work for them. I know that college students who are in real colleges still have people that will write papers for them but they still have to go and take the test.
